Chasing Lies

Whatever is used that you think is needed to be happy will be what becomes your chase. It’s not right or wrong, but the key is to understand if what you’re chasing will truly provide what you think it will…

The biggest misunderstanding of my writings are that the view of life I have today is the view I always had. To me, whoever is looked upon for inspiration or whatever, it should be noted that most likely they didn’t always see things as they do now. I’m fortunate to have experienced two totally different ways of viewing life; it’s where my insights arise from and the reason why I share what I do. Having lived chasing for so many years has actually become my greatest asset. When I write about something it’s always from a lesson that I learned, it’s never about being smarter or knowing more than anyone else. What is there is simply what’s there and it’s what’s shared. When I talk about quietness or stillness it’s because I lived a life full of chasing. When there’s talk of attachment, it’s because attachment was my master.

Everyone alive experiences life, what’s done with the experience determines what’s chased. An example is if you think you need a certain status to be happy that will be your chase. It’s not right or wrong, but the key is to understand if what is chased will provide what you think it will. Deep down inside having a certain status doesn’t change you; substitute status with anything. For me I went through a life of much suffering chasing what my Conditioned Mind made me believe was happiness; today I see this for the lie that it is. When I write something it’s because I can see the self serving chase I was stuck in; today I have been provided with a view of true liberation. I may be very direct in my approach, but I’m not insensitive to anyone else’s view, it’s just that I’ve been where most people are and I can see the chasing of lies that far too many remain stuck in…
